When you look at a tree, the 잎사귀 (leaf) is the part that catches the sunlight. It is the powerhouse of the plant!

While is the standard, everyday word for leaf, 잎사귀 feels a bit more descriptive. You might use it in a poem or when you want to highlight the shape and texture of the leaves themselves.

Think of it as the 'leaf-part' of the plant. It's a lovely word that brings to mind nature and the changing seasons, especially when you see them turning colors in the autumn.

The word 잎사귀 is a combination of (leaf) and the suffix -사귀. Historically, this suffix has been used to denote a part or a piece of something.

In older Korean, the distinction between simple nouns and those with descriptive suffixes was common to differentiate between the general concept and the physical object. It has evolved from simple agricultural usage to a more literary term in modern Korean.

You will hear 잎사귀 in contexts where nature is being described. It is very common in literature, songs, and casual conversation about gardening.

Common collocations include 잎사귀가 흔들리다 (the leaf is shaking) or 잎사귀를 따다 (to pick a leaf). It is slightly more expressive than just saying .

Use it when you want to sound a little more poetic or when you are focusing on the physical leaf itself rather than the plant as a whole.

1. 잎사귀가 무성하다: To have thick, lush leaves (often used for a healthy plant).

2. 잎사귀 하나 없는: Without a single leaf (describing bare trees in winter).

3. 잎사귀가 말라비틀어지다: The leaf has withered away (describing a dying plant).

4. 잎사귀 사이로: Through the leaves (often used for sunlight filtering through).

5. 잎사귀를 틔우다: To sprout leaves (the beginning of spring).

In Korean, 잎사귀 is a standard noun. It does not change form for pluralization in the same way English does, as plurality is understood from context.

The pronunciation is [입싸귀]. Note the tense sound in the middle '싸'.

It is a concrete noun and is count-neutral, meaning you use it to talk about one leaf or many leaves depending on the sentence structure.
